  • the invention relates to a temporary holding device according to the preamble of claim 1, in particular for use in a vehicle door hinge, in order to temporarily hold a vehicle door in an open position.
  • the invention also relates to a vehicle hinge according to the preamble of claim 9 and a holding system according to the preamble of claim 12.
  • the vehicle body and vehicle doors are typically painted together in a single process step after the vehicle doors have been assembled to the body. It is desirable to lock vehicle doors temporarily held in an open position so that certain painting operations, e.g. B. a top coat finish can be performed.
  • CN 204 492 417 U describes a temporary retaining device for a vehicle hinge, which fixes first and second hinge parts.
  • the holding device comprises a removable flat section for a stop part designed as a pin, which is arranged on the first hinge part and is used during the painting of the vehicle body, including the vehicle doors that have already been installed, in order to lock the vehicle doors in a defined open position.
  • the flat section is mounted on the second hinge part for this purpose, with a fold extending from the flat section being inserted into a recess in the second hinge part so that it can be coupled.
  • the flat section comprises a total of two openings, one of which is penetrated by a provisional hinge pin, which also penetrates the two hinge parts and connects them to one another in an articulated manner.
  • the second opening of the flat section is provided for the pin to snap into place.
  • the flat section has a bent upwards, tongue-like ramp section, which is arranged asymmetrically with respect to the fold. In order to lock the vehicle door, it is pivoted so that the ramp section contacts the pin and at the same time is guided up on the pin. Finally, the flat section is displaced partially vertically upwards until the second opening snaps into place with the pin. From then on, the vehicle door is locked in an open position.
  • the hinge pin can also be displaced upwards in its longitudinal direction by the displacement or by a substantially vertical movement of the flat section.
  • the hinge bolt can come loose from a lower hinge eye of a hinge part, so that the two hinge parts of the vehicle door hinge are no longer fully coupled.
  • an additional safety ring is mounted in a radial groove at the lower end of the hinge pin to prevent the hinge pin from shifting in its longitudinal direction.
  • the pin, the openings of the flat section and the position of the flat section specified by the hinge pin or by the second hinge part make the holding system, consisting of a holding device and a vehicle hinge, susceptible to problems due to tolerance deviations, so that the functionality of the holding device is unreliable is.
  • this object is achieved by a temporary holding device having the features of claim 1 or by a vehicle hinge having the features of claim 9 or by a holding system having the features of claim 12 solved.
  • a temporary retention device for use in a vehicle hinge to temporarily lock a vehicle door in an open position relative to a door frame, comprising a planar portion having an opening therein, extending from an edge of the planar portion a fold protrudes.
  • the holding device is characterized in that a load arm extends from the flat section, and in that the load arm has an embossing designed as a holding lug at an end remote from the flat section.
  • the holding device can be coupled in a simple manner to a hinge part of a vehicle hinge in order to specify a preferred opening angle of a door coupled to the vehicle via the hinge.
  • the holding device is easy to manufacture and in particular enables the hinge parts to be reliably fixed relative to one another without complicated threading in or out being necessary for this purpose.
  • the functions of securing the hinge parts against pivoting in one direction and in the other direction are advantageously decoupled, so that the holding device can also be disengaged again without being destroyed.
  • the retaining lug expediently comprises a flat mating surface on the one hand and a guide bevel on the other.
  • the mating surface is intended to come into clamping or gripping engagement with an end face of a stop part arranged on a hinge part and accordingly to provide a fixation that defines the preferred opening angle with a minimum moment to be overcome.
  • the retaining lug is expediently provided outside the plane of the load arm and is supported by a guide bevel, which can be designed as a bulbous expression of the load arm. As a result, the moments can be transmitted in a particularly favorable manner.
  • the load arm is expediently elastically bendable in the radial direction, so that cushioning of an impact occurs when torque is applied toward the outer surface of the load arm.
  • a free end of the load arm has an arcuate section, which thus advantageously defines a guide bevel that promotes pivoting past the stop part arranged on the hinge side.
  • the fold is expediently designed as a surface of the flat section that is folded over by approximately 90°. However, it is possible to form the fold in a step-like manner or, preferably, in a wavy manner.
  • the fold is used in particular to come into planar contact with the complementarily shaped end face of a hinge part.
  • the flat section preferably has a bead which is provided for stiffening and stabilizing the flat section and which also ensures elastic deformability so that the flat section can be adapted to tolerances of the hinge part to which it is to be connected.
  • the bead also makes it easier to remove the temporary holding device after use.
  • the load arm is preferably designed in such a way that when the load arm is elastically displaced in the radial direction, relatively low stresses occur inside the load arm, with the load arm having a high degree of rigidity, particularly in the tangential direction, which makes it possible to apply a torque in a range of 2 Nm to 20 Nm without the load arm buckling or bending.
  • the holding device is formed in one piece from a single piece of material.
  • a steel sheet that is shaped by stamping and is thin-walled and elastic at the same time is particularly suitable for this purpose.
  • the load arm has a contact surface which is provided adjacent to the retaining lug for interaction with a stop part which is arranged on one of the hinge parts.
  • the contact surface limits the pivoting in one direction, while the retaining lug limits the pivoting in the other direction by clamping.
  • the retaining lug is connected to the stop in a frictionally or force-fitting manner, while the contact surface prevents further opening in a form-fitting manner. The contact surface thus limits the pivoting movement in the opening direction, while the retaining lug prevents the pivoting movement in the closing direction.
  • a vehicle hinge comprising a first hinge part with a fastening surface for connection to a door or to a door frame, and at least one bracket in which a hinge eye is arranged, with a stop part being arranged on a surface of the bracket, a second hinge part, and a hinge pin passing through the first and second hinge parts and pivotally connecting the first and second hinge parts together about a pivot axis.
  • the vehicle hinge is preferably characterized in that the stop part is designed as a U-shaped bracket with two legs and a base connecting the legs, each of which protrudes from the extension arm.
  • the vehicle hinge thus advantageously provides a stop part that can be connected to the extension arm in a simple manner and provides a number of surfaces to which different functions can be assigned.
  • the U-bend shackle provides a large surface area without increasing the mass of the striker.
  • the bracket bent in a U-shape makes it possible for different outward-facing surfaces of the legs or the base to have different parts cooperate and each provide a defined opening angle of the door to be attached via the vehicle hinge.
  • the stop part expediently limits the pivoting movement of the hinge parts and defines a maximum opening angle of the hinge.
  • a cantilever of the second hinge part strikes the stop part, preferably at its base, which ensures that the vehicle door does not roll over.
  • legs of a preferably U-shaped stop part run approximately parallel to the fastening surface of the first hinge part, so that the load arm can be guided past the U-shaped bracket without tilting.
  • One of the legs of the U-shaped bracket expediently has an end face remote from the base, which is designed to interact with the holding lug of a temporary holding device, as described above.
  • the end face is designed to be smooth, so that the retaining lug comes into contact with the end face under the prestressing of the load arm.
  • the end face can be formed by flat embossings on the stop part or on the U-shaped bracket. These can in the structural design of the stop part or the U-shaped bracket z. B. by a choice of flat or angled sheets or profiles, z. B. square profiles can be realized.
  • the retaining lug also engages in the intermediate space between the two legs through the opening of the U facing away from the base and thus also provides a form fit instead of or in addition to the frictional fixing. If the door is moved in the closing direction with a moment that exceeds 20 Nm, for example, the retaining lug is decoupled without the need for manual processing of the retaining device.
  • the U-shaped bracket is arranged with its base on the boom and between the A passage is arranged on the legs of the U-shaped bracket, which runs transversely, preferably at an angle of up to 45°, to a plane to the fastening surface.
  • the passage of the U-shaped bracket offers a possibility to use a defined adapter piece in this passage.
  • the angle is in a range between 5° and 25°, preferably between 7° and 15° and particularly preferably the angle is approximately 10° in order to advantageously lock a vehicle door at a defined opening angle.
  • a holding system for an automobile body shell to be painted comprising a hinge as described above, and a holding device as described above, wherein instead of the hinge pin of the hinge, a provisional hinge bolt couples the hinge parts in a pivotable manner and, moreover, the holding device connects to the second hinge part, wherein the holding lug of the arm of the holding device can be braced on the leg of the bracket, in particular on its front side, or on an adapter piece connected to the bracket, in order to lock the two hinge parts in a predetermined opening angle.
  • a provisional hinge bolt couples the hinge parts in a pivotable manner and, moreover, the holding device connects to the second hinge part, wherein the holding lug of the arm of the holding device can be braced on the leg of the bracket, in particular on its front side, or on an adapter piece connected to the bracket, in order to lock the two hinge parts in a predetermined opening angle.
  • the temporary hinge pin and bracket are discarded or recycled, and when the doors are reconnected to the body, the actual hinge pin is used to pivot the connection.
  • the fold of the holding device can be coupled to the second hinge part, and is preferably in a corresponding Recess definable. Due to the angle that the fold and the flat section have in relation to one another, favorable bracing occurs on the second hinge part.
  • the holding device and the second hinge part preferably have the same axis of rotation.
  • the holding force generated by the holding device in order to temporarily lock a vehicle door in the open position preferably has a torque of 2 Nm to 20 Nm, preferably 10 Nm to 18 Nm, particularly preferably 15 Nm to 17 Nm. This ensures that vibrations, which are not sufficient during transport of the body shell to be painted, to close the vehicle door locked in the open position by the holding device, so that a high level of reproducibility during painting work is ensured.
  • an adapter piece designed as a double-bent sheet metal part is inserted with its central region between the legs of the U-shaped bracket and that the retaining lug can be connected to an outer part of the double-bent sheet metal part.
  • different adapter pieces with, for example, differently defined stop surfaces and geometries or different materials can be used in the U-shaped bracket in order to ensure, for example, much higher torques for locking a vehicle door. This aspect increases the flexibility and range of use of the holding system.
  • a vehicle hinge 1 which comprises a first hinge part 20 and a second hinge part 25 .
  • the first hinge part 20 is mounted with a mounting surface 21 on a door frame R, shown in phantom, so that consequently the second hinge part 25 is mounted on a vehicle door T, also shown in phantom. It is possible that the second hinge part 25 to the door frame R and the first hinge part 20 at the vehicle door T is connected.
  • the holding device 10 which is also made from sheet steel, comprises a flat section 11 which has an opening 12 .
  • the holding device 10 is positioned on the second hinge part 25 such that the opening 12 is aligned with the hinge eye 32 of the second hinge part 25 and the flat section 11 of the holding device 10 is positioned planar on the second hinge part 25 .
  • a provisional hinge pin 30 engages both through the opening 12 of the holding device 10 and through the two hinge parts 20 and 25, after which the first and the second hinge part 20 and 25 and the holding device 10 are connected to one another in an articulated manner about an axis of rotation D.
  • the holding device 10 has a coupling element designed as a fold 13 .
  • the bevel 13 extends in a stepped or wavy manner from an edge 11a of the flat section 11 of the holding device 10 .
  • the fact that the second hinge part 25 has a corresponding recess which is positively adapted to the shape of the fold 13 makes it possible to insert the fold 13 in the recess of the second hinge part 25 and finally achieve a non-rotatable coupling or interaction of the holding device 10 with form the second hinge part 25 .
  • the holding device 10 also includes a load arm 14 which extends from the flat section 11 of the holding device 10 .
  • a free end 14a of the load arm 14 has, on the one hand, a lateral embossment designed as a retaining lug 15 and, on the other hand, an arcuate section 18 .
  • the load arm 14 has a lateral contact surface 19 .
  • the vehicle hinge 1 is shown with the built-in holding device 10 from a bird's eye view.
  • the load arm 14 is guided tangentially past the stop part 24, with the lateral stop surface 19 of the load arm 14 contacting a leg 26 of the stop part 24 until the second hinge part 25 with its stop 25a through a base 28 of the stop member 24 is stopped.
  • a bead 31 is introduced within the flat section 11 of the holding device 10 in order to give the holding device 10 a certain stability and rigidity.
  • In 3 1 is a front view of the retainer 10 and stop member 24 in a locked position. It can be seen that the holding device 10 has a flat section 11 from which the load arm 14 extends upwards. The retaining lug 15 of the load arm 14 acts orthogonally on a counter-surface 29 of the stop part 24 in order to ensure that the hinge 1 is locked in a functional manner.
  • figure 5 essentially corresponds to the 2 .
  • the two hinge parts 20 and 25 as well as the hinge pin 30 are in figure 5 not shown.
  • the holding device 10 and the stop part 24 are shown in a view from above, with the holding device 10 and the stop part 24 being in a locked position. Because the hinge pin 30 is not shown, the opening 12 of the holding device 10 is now visible.
  • FIG. 6 1 is an enlarged view of the free end 14a of the load arm 14 in cooperation with the stop member 24.
  • the retaining lug 15 comprises a guide bevel 17, which is formed laterally as a ramp or as a convex or rounded elevation, and a flat mating surface 16, which interacts with the preferably sharp-edged end face 29 of the stop part 24 and correspondingly locks the hinge parts 20 and 25.
  • the load arm 14 includes an arcuate section 18 so that the load arm 14 does not cant when passing the base 28 of the stop part 24 but can be guided past the U-shaped bracket 24 tangentially. At this time, the load arm 14 is slightly elastically bent in the direction of the hinge pin 30 by the stopper 24 .
  • a permanent hinge pin S is then inserted into the hinge eyes 32 and 33 of the hinge parts 20 and 25 and then riveted, whereby the vehicle hinge is completed.
  • the stop part 24 accordingly remains permanently on the first hinge part 20 since it also serves to limit the opening angle of a vehicle door T by means of the base 28 .
